简介:本文深入探讨了Android蓝牙语音接口的工作原理、调试方法及其在智能语音产品中的应用,同时推荐了一款高性价比的蓝牙语音芯片,并探讨了如何将其融入Android设备中。
随着智能语音产品的需求日益增长,Android蓝牙语音接口作为连接智能设备与互联网的桥梁,其重要性日益凸显。本文将深入探讨Android蓝牙语音接口的工作原理、调试技巧,并结合实际应用场景,分析其在智能语音产品中的应用。
Android蓝牙语音接口主要通过蓝牙技术实现智能设备与手机或其他蓝牙设备之间的语音数据传输。这一过程涉及蓝牙适配器的初始化、设备搜索与连接、数据传输等多个环节。具体来说,首先需要在Android设备上获取BluetoothAdapter实例,并通过该实例搜索附近的蓝牙设备。当找到目标设备后,通过BluetoothSocket建立连接,进而实现语音数据的传输。
在语音数据传输过程中,为了保证音质和传输效率,需要采用适当的音频编码格式,如SBC、ADPCM等。同时,蓝牙芯片的性能也直接影响语音传输的质量和稳定性。一款优秀的蓝牙语音芯片应具备低功耗、高稳定性、高保真等特点。
在实际开发中,Android蓝牙语音接口的调试是一个关键环节。以下是一些常用的调试技巧:
在蓝牙语音芯片的选择上,夏杰语音XJ2100蓝牙语音芯片无疑是一个高性价比的选择。该芯片基于智能语音技术和BLE5.2蓝牙连接,具有高压缩比、高保真、识别率高、反馈精准等特点。同时,XJ2100蓝牙语音芯片自带微系统,包含算法在内的进程都可独立完成,不占主设备资源,适用于不同系统环境。此外,该芯片还具备兼容性强、免补丁、集成快等优势,对于想要快速升级自家产品又不想重新开发设备系统的厂商来说,是一个理想的选择。
Android蓝牙语音接口在智能语音产品中具有广泛的应用场景。例如,在可穿戴设备中,通过蓝牙语音接口,用户可以轻松实现语音控制功能,如接听电话、发送短信等。在智能家居领域,蓝牙语音接口可以实现智能家电的语音控制,提升用户的使用体验。此外,在医疗、工业等领域,蓝牙语音接口也发挥着重要作用。
以一款基于Android系统的智能音箱为例,该音箱通过内置的蓝牙语音接口与手机进行连接。用户可以通过语音指令控制音箱播放音乐、查询天气等。在实现过程中,首先需要在音箱端和手机端分别开启蓝牙功能,并通过蓝牙适配器搜索并连接对方设备。然后,通过BluetoothSocket建立连接,实现语音数据的传输。为了保证音质和传输效率,音箱端采用了高性能的蓝牙语音芯片,并进行了详细的调试和优化。
Android蓝牙语音接口作为智能语音产品的重要组成部分,其性能和稳定性直接影响用户的使用体验。通过深入了解其工作原理、掌握调试技巧,并结合实际应用场景进行选择和优化,我们可以为智能语音产品提供更加高效、稳定的蓝牙语音接口。同时,选择一款高性价比的蓝牙语音芯片也是提升产品竞争力的关键所在。在未来的发展中,随着蓝牙技术的不断进步和应用场景的不断拓展,Android蓝牙语音接口将迎来更加广阔的发展前景。